Physical properties
Hardness of 7 on the Mohs scale, milky white to greyish color with dark or black tourmaline patches, vitreous to greasy luster, trigonal crystal system, conchoidal fracture, specific gravity of 2.65.
Formation & geological history
Formed in hydrothermal veins and pegmatites, where hot, silica-rich fluids cool and crystallize over millions of years.
Uses & applications
Used in mineral collecting, lapidary arts, decorative items, and occasionally holistic or metaphysical practices.
Geological facts
Milky quartz is the most common variety of crystalline quartz found on Earth. The milky appearance is caused by microscopic fluid inclusions trapped during crystal growth.
Field identification & locations
Easily identified by its hardness (scratches glass), lack of cleavage, and conchoidal fracture. Found worldwide in nearly all geological environments.
